相关文章
模块二-数据选择与索引——09. query() 方法
09. query() 方法
1. 概述
query() 方法是 Pandas 提供的一种使用字符串表达式进行数据筛选的方式。相比布尔索引,query() 更简洁、可读性更强,特别适合复杂条件筛选。
import pandas as pd
import numpy as np# 创建示例数据
np.random.seed(42)
df pd…
建站知识
2026/5/13 1:18:57
面试官问LDA和PCA的区别?别慌,用这个可视化项目(Python+Matplotlib)一次讲清楚
面试官问LDA和PCA的区别?用Python可视化讲透本质差异
当被问到"LDA和PCA有什么区别"时,很多人的回答停留在"一个有监督一个无监督"的层面。这种回答就像说"咖啡和茶都是饮品"一样正确但毫无信息量。本文将用鸢尾花数据集&…
建站知识
2026/5/13 1:18:57
连接器选型实战:五大隐形陷阱与设计硬核避坑指南
许多硬件工程师在原理图和PCB上投入大量精力,却往往在连接器选型上“凭经验”、“看样品”草草了事。然而,从返修统计来看,连接器相关问题占据了现场故障的近三成,且故障模式极其隐蔽——时断时续、温升爬升、误码率偶发。本文从电…
建站知识
2026/5/13 1:18:57
模块二-数据选择与索引——07. 行选择与切片
07. 行选择与切片
1. 概述
行选择是数据筛选的核心操作。Pandas 提供了多种行选择方式:按位置选择、按标签选择、切片操作等。理解 loc 和 iloc 的区别是掌握行选择的关键。
import pandas as pd
import numpy as np# 创建示例数据
df pd.DataFrame({姓名: [张三, …
建站知识
2026/5/13 1:18:57
LLM 是怎么调用工具的?一文讲清 Tool Calling、MCP 和 Agent 编排(含代码示例)
LLM 是怎么调用工具的?一文讲清 Tool Calling、MCP 和 Agent 编排 现在很多人都在讲 Agent,但真正开始做 Agent 系统后,你会发现一个很现实的问题: 大模型本身并不会真正操作外部世界,它只是会“提出调用工具的意图”。 比如用户说: 帮我读取 D:/demo/a.txt 里的内容,然…
建站知识
2026/5/13 1:18:57
校园快递平台系统(文档+源码)_kaic
第5章 系统实现编程人员在搭建的开发环境中,会让各种编程技术一起呈现出最终效果。本节就展示关键部分的页面效果。5.1 管理员功能实现5.1.1 订单管理图5.1 即为编码实现的订单管理界面,管理员在订单管理界面中可以对界面中显示,可以对订单信…
建站知识
2026/5/13 1:17:57
为什么长期做量化,一定要先搭建自己的“数据中台”
为什么长期做量化,一定要先搭建自己的“数据中台”
很多人做量化,第一步就开始研究策略。
今天学一个 MACD,
明天学一个 AI 选股,
后天开始回测,
结果半年后发现:
策略越来越多,
代码越来越乱&a…
建站知识
2026/5/13 1:17:57
形式化方法和《大象》这本书
形式化方法和《大象》这本书
一、形式化方法
形式化方法就是用数学和逻辑的严谨思路来搞软件开发,不再靠 “大概”“应该” 这种模糊的文字描述系统需求,而是用一套精准的符号和模型把系统的规则、行为都写死,再通过专门的工具去验证系统有没…
建站知识
2026/5/13 1:17:57

